The Direct Path to Croesus

To access the Croesus boss fight in RS3, you’ll need to navigate the Elder God Wars Dungeon, specifically the Senntisten area. Here’s the precise path:

  1. Reach the Senntisten Area: The Croesus Front is located in the eastern section of Senntisten. To get there, you’ll first need to enter the Elder God Wars Dungeon. The most common entrance is the ancient door located north of the Archaeology Guild and directly east of Tolna’s rift.
  2. Navigate to the Croesus Front: Once inside the Senntisten area, head east. You’ll see a clearly marked area labeled “Croesus Front”. This is the staging ground before the boss arena.
  3. Join a Team or Instance: Croesus is a group boss, so you’ll want to join a team or public instance. Players have commonly gathered on World 68 to form teams, but keep an eye out for popular worlds and clans organizing events.
  4. Enter the Arena: Once you’re with a team, you’ll be able to enter the main Croesus arena and begin the fight.

This straightforward path is your key to facing Croesus. Remember, teamwork is essential for a successful encounter.

Prerequisites for Croesus

While the above steps outline the route, there are a few key prerequisites to keep in mind:

  • Combat Level: While there isn’t a specific combat level requirement, a solid combat level is highly recommended. A level of 80+ in most combat skills is a good starting point, with the ability to use tier 70+ equipment.
  • Skill Levels: Though Croesus is not combat-focused, it requires gathering skills to weaken it and receive rewards. Having 80+ in multiple gathering skills like Fishing, Woodcutting, Mining, and Hunter will make your contributions more effective.
  • Basic Gear: You’ll want a set of reasonable armor, a good weapon, and tools for gathering. Although, the emphasis is not on traditional combat gear.
  • Teamwork: It’s critical to find a group, whether through public worlds or a clan. Communication is crucial for a smooth experience.

1. What is the ideal contribution score for Croesus rewards?

A minimum of 420 contribution is required to receive the maximum of 12 drop rolls after each encounter. You need at least 60 contribution to obtain a unique drop. Maximizing your gathering efforts during the encounter will ensure you meet these thresholds.

10. What does “rich as Croesus” mean?

The phrase “rich as Croesus” refers to King Croesus, an ancient king known for his immense wealth. It’s a common expression meaning extremely rich. The phrase comes from his history where he was one of the first kings to mint his own coins of gold and silver.
